Is 43x26mm an ovarian cyst?

If the examination reveals a 43x26mm occupancy in the adnexal area, it may be an ovarian cyst. Ovarian cysts are cystic structures formed within or on the surface of the ovary due to stimulation by environmental and hormonal factors, including physiological cysts such as corpus luteum cysts and follicular cysts and pathological cysts such as teratomas and ovarian chocolate cysts. 1. Physiological cysts: follicular cysts and corpus luteum cysts are formed as a result of cyclic changes in the ovaries, and the echogenicity of the cysts is uniform in ultrasound, and they can disappear on their own after 2~3 menstrual cycles. 2. Pathologic cysts: (1) teratoma: it is mostly due to the formation of embryonic cells, and the distribution of grease, hair or bone can be seen in the cyst, and the ultrasound examination can find localized strong echoes of star pattern. (2) Ovarian chocolate cysts: this disease is a type of endometriosis, ectopic endometrium planted in the ovary, with the ovarian cycle changes and local bleeding and other manifestations, over time will form a cyst-like occupation, ultrasound performance is mud-like echoes. For gynecological ultrasound examination found in the adnexal area of 43x26mm occupation, it is necessary to be vigilant about the occurrence of ovarian cysts, it is recommended that patients go to the gynecology department of the regular hospital, clear cause of the cause of the disease under the guidance of the doctor active treatment.
